The , also known as the Andrew Jackson Cottage, is the ancestral home of Andrew Jackson, 7th President of the . It is located in the village of Boneybefore in , .

is a large town 12 miles northeast of Belfast, historically in . It grew up around the 12th-century Norman castle that is now the centre of its tourism business.
